Timesheet Status Report

This report shows the status of a timesheet, the hours completed by an individual, the amount of hours an individual should be showing based on a 8 hour Monday - Friday work week, and the percentage of hours completed thus far for a given time period. The report also shows Pending Project Manager and Customer Approvals when the status of the Timesheet is Submitted or Approving. 

Note: when time applies to a Project that does not require Project Manager or Customer approval, there would be no PM or Customer Pending Approvals. Displayed below are the query screen and the results screen.

 

Person Organization - shows all Organizations that each person belongs to. This is a field on Person page when you create a new Person record.

Approval Group - shows all Approval Groups that are created in the system. For more details on the Unanet approval process see Setting up Approval Groups.

People - all People that are assigned to the Projects are shown here. 

Timesheet Status - the different statuses that are used to track a timesheet. 

Classification - select which user classifications to include in the results.

Time Period - lists the time periods that are set up in the system.

Enter Date - the report will list the status of the timesheets in a Date Range that is determined by  the selected Time Period and Date.

Report Options - whether this report should simply include the timesheet status section or additionally include a listing of all associated timesheets with appropriate details (e.g. the preview versions of each of the timesheets).   This feature was added to assist with the ability to perform a mass print of timesheets (see the note about printing that accompanies the example below).

Note: When selecting the Detailed report option, depending on the quantity of timesheets included in your selection criteria, the report may take up to several minutes to display.  So you know when the report has completed, your screen will read 'Details Complete' at the bottom of the listing (see the example below).  

By default, the Summary only report is selected.  If you select the 'Timesheet Status Report (Detail)', you can then optionally also include the Cell Comments, Approval History, Audit History, Adjustment Detail and Print View Footer sections (if they exist for each particular timesheet being displayed).  The Audit History check box will only appear if this system is configured with the unatime.audit property set to true.  The Print View Footer check box option will only appear if this system is configured with one of the three  Timesheet Print View Footer text.property settings active.

Note the section at the top is similar to the Summary report above.  The section at the bottom will contain a preview version of each user's timesheet in the list above.  By clicking on the eye-glasses in the top summary section, you can jump down to the associated timesheet detail in the lower detail section.

Each timesheet in the detail section is separated by a bold gray bar.  This page may also be useful for the purposes of bulk printing of timesheets.  This page was constructed with embedded form feeds which are currently recognized by the Internet Explorer 5.0 or above browser (sorry Netscape users -- you can still print, but you won't have a form feed between each timesheet).

Timesheet Status Report for the Viewer

Privilege Needed: Viewer

The Unanet role called "Viewer" has access to two reports that contain time information for people that belong to the same Person Organization as the Viewer User. The Timesheet Status report is one of these reports. (The other report is the Organization Time Report). 

The selection screen for the Timesheet Status report does not include the Person Organization and the Approval Group, since the "Viewer" only has access to information for people in the same Organization. The report output itself looks the same as the original Timesheet Status report.
